Understanding ADHD Assessment Tests: An In-Depth Guide

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D) is a neurodevelopmental condition that affects both kids and adults. People with ADHD frequently battle with concentration, impulsivity, and hyperactivity, resulting in obstacles in academic, professional, and social settings. Acknowledging these symptoms and getting a proper diagnosis is essential for efficient management and assistance. One of the initial steps in the diagnostic procedure is an ADHD assessment test. This post delves into the numerous elements of ADHD assessment tests, their significance, methodologies, and answers to often asked questions.

What is an ADHD Assessment Test?

An ADHD assessment test is a systematic examination performed by health care experts to identify whether a private fulfills the requirements for ADHD. These evaluations usually integrate self-reported questionnaires, behavioral examinations, and observations from parents, teachers, or therapists.  iampsychiatry  is to gain a detailed view of a person's behavior throughout different contexts.

Parts of an ADHD Assessment Test

ADHD assessment tests can differ in structure, however most include the following key elements:

ComponentDescription
Self-Report QuestionnairesIndividuals total surveys concerning their symptoms and habits, frequently using rating scales.
Behavioral ObservationsObservations may be made in numerous settings, such as home and school, to assess everyday functioning.
Parent and Teacher ReportsStudies completed by parents and teachers offer insight into the individual's habits in various contexts.
Medical InterviewA health professional carries out a structured interview to collect detailed individual history and symptomatology.
Additional AssessmentsCognitive or academic assessments may become part of the assessment to eliminate learning disabilities or other conditions.

Typical ADHD Assessment Tools

A number of standardized tools and questionnaires are extensively utilized in ADHD evaluations:

  1. ADHD Rating Scale (ADHD-RS): This tool measures the severity of symptoms in children and teenagers based upon moms and dad and teacher assessments.
  2. Conners 3rd Edition: An assessment tool that evaluates behavioral, psychological, and scholastic problems in kids and teenagers.
  3. Vanderbilt ADHD Diagnostic Rating Scale: A thorough tool utilized in both scientific and school settings, providing a detailed profile of ADHD symptoms.
  4.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ale (ASRS): This screening tool assists adults evaluate their symptoms to figure out the need for additional assessment.
  5. Habits Assessment System for Children (BASC): This tool encompasses a broad series of behaviors and feelings in kids and can assist recognize comorbid conditions.

The Assessment Process

The ADHD assessment procedure might incorporate numerous phases:

  1. Initial Consultation: They meet a health care expert to talk about concerns and symptoms.
  2. Questionnaire Completion: Individuals total self-reports, and parents/teachers offer input through surveys.
  3. Observation: The critic observes behavior in various settings, if appropriate.
  4. Interview: A scientific interview is performed to gather detailed historical context surrounding the symptoms.
  5. Feedback Session: Upon conclusion of the assessment, the healthcare expert reviews findings with the individual and provides assistance on subsequent actions.

Frequently Asked Question about ADHD Assessment Tests

1. How long does an ADHD assessment take?

The time frame for an ADHD assessment can differ, typically varying from one hour for initial screenings to a number of hours over numerous consultations for thorough examinations.

2. Who performs ADHD evaluations?

ADHD assessments are typically performed by specialists trained in psychological health, such as psychologists, psychiatrists, or pediatricians.

3. Are ADHD assessment tests covered by insurance coverage?

Protection for ADHD evaluations varies by insurance coverage provider and strategy. It's advised to talk to your particular insurance strategy regarding coverage information.

4. Is there any preparation required for an ADHD assessment?

While no extensive preparation is typically needed, collecting details about previous habits, school reports, and any previous assessments can be valuable.

5. What happens after the assessment?

Post-assessment, people receive feedback on the findings and suggestions for continuous management or treatment methods, which might include therapy, medication, or way of life changes.
